Answer:

0.16 g of Mg

Explanation:

since O2 is limiting reagent then as in the reaction -

2Mg+O2 - 2MgO

32g of 02 reacts with 48g of Mg and

1g of O2 will need 48/32g of Mg

and 0.56g of O2 will need 48/32 ×0.56 =0.84 g of Mg

then when subtracted from 1 g of magnesium the amount of residue of mg will be 0.16g
